The age and sex distribution of COVID-19 cases and fatalities in India

Using anonymous publicly available data on COVID-19 infections and gross outcomes in India, the age and sex distribution of infections and fatalities is studied. The age structure in the count of infections is not proportional to that in the population, indicating the role of either co-morbidity or differential attack rate. There is a strong age structure in the sex ratio of cases, with the female to male ratio being about 50% on average. The ratio drops between puberty and menopause. No such structure is visible in the sex ratio of fatalities. The overall age distribution of fatalities is consistent with a model which uses the empirical age structure of infections and a previous determinations of age structured IFR. The average IFR for India is then expected to be 0.4% with a 95% CrI in [0.22%, 0.77%].
